Nestled in the serene valleys of Bumthang, Amankora offers tourists a luxurious escape enriched by Bhutanese culture and hospitality. This stunning hotel, located near the historic Wangdichholing Palace, provides a perfect base for exploring the enchanting landscapes and spiritual heritage of Bhutan.

Car
If you are driving in Bumthang Valley, head towards Jakar town. From Jakar, follow the main road leading towards Wangdichholing Palace. The Amankora, Bumthang is located near this palace. Look for road signs indicating the lodge, as it is a well-known location in the area. The drive from Jakar to the lodge should take approximately 10-15 minutes depending on traffic conditions.
Taxi
You can hire a taxi from anywhere in Bumthang Valley. Just inform the driver that you want to go to Amankora, Bumthang, which is located near Wangdichholing Palace in Jakar. The taxi fare is typically around 200-300 Ngultrum for a short trip within the valley, and it should take about 10-15 minutes to reach your destination.
Public Bus
While there may not be a direct bus line to Amankora, Bumthang, you can take a local bus to Jakar town. Once you arrive in Jakar, you can easily find a taxi or ask locals for directions to Amankora, which is nearby Wangdichholing Palace. Public buses usually charge about 50 Ngultrum for the ride to Jakar, but schedules can be infrequent, so check the local timetable.
